Title: Navigating the Challenges of Transforming Your Dissertation Into a Book
Embarking on the journey of turning your dissertation into a book is a daunting task that many scholars find challenging. The process requires not only a profound understanding of your subject matter but also the ability to present your research in a way that engages a broader audience. As you delve into this endeavor, you may encounter numerous hurdles that can make the process seem overwhelming.
One of the primary challenges is the need for extensive reworking. Dissertations are typically written for a specific academic audience, using a formal and specialized language. Transforming this content into a book that appeals to a wider readership involves not only simplifying complex concepts but also restructuring the narrative to enhance its flow and readability.
Another obstacle is the pressure to contribute something new. While your dissertation may have been groundbreaking within the confines of academia, a book demands a fresh perspective and innovative approach. This requires a careful balance between maintaining the integrity of your research and presenting it in a way that captivates a broader range of readers.
Time constraints also play a significant role in the difficulty of this process. Many scholars are already juggling various commitments, and adding the task of converting a dissertation into a book can be overwhelming. The demands of teaching, research, and other responsibilities can leave little time for the extensive revisions and rewriting required.
